London, Jun 30: The 2025 Wimbledon Championship kicked off in superb fashion as Benjamin Bonzi wasted little time in notching the first major upset by stunning ninth seed Daniil Medvedev 7-6(2), 3-6, 7-6(3), 6-2 in the men’s singles first round here on Monday.
Ranked ninth in the ATP ranking, Medvedev has had a horrid run in Grand Slams this year. His first-round Wimbledon exit follows after a second-round defeat to Learner Tien at the Australian Open and a first-round loss to Cameron Norrie at Roland Garros.
Competing on the hottest opening day ever recorded at the grass-court major, according to the Met Office, the World No. 64 Bonzi’s precision and patience from the back of the court proved too much for Medvedev during their first-round clash.
